About Newtown 2042

The size of Newtown is approximately 1.6 square kilometres. There are 18 parks, covering nearly 3.7% of the total area. The population of Newtown in 2016 was 15029 people. By 2021 the population was 14690 showing a population decline of 2.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Newtown is 20-29 years. Households in Newtown are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Newtown work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 40.70% of the homes in Newtown were owner-occupied compared with 38.50% in 2016.
